Default Is this my Ignition switch?

OK so far I have had no one give their opinion in tech so I'll try here.



--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
A couple weeks ago I started getting the intermittent STC and EBS lights and warnings.

It was intermittent at first and then got to where they stayed on. Then all of a sudden they disappeared, but as I was out driving the other day they came on again and of course won't go out now.

Then last week I was sitting at a stop sign preparing to turn right the car just died. I thought, or was hoping, I had it in third. Started it up and it ran fine.

Went to put the car up for a few days and I started it and the dash lights started going crazy, on and off, and I got the low voltage warning. Then the car stuggled to idle, it started bucking, (like you were turning the car on and off rapidly). But then sometimes I would turn it off, and it would fire right up. The warning lights still on though. And this time I got the srvice engine light as well. There was also a couple times it would just crank and not fire at all.

Pulled codes and they were all associated with the TCS 1232 through 1235 H C, to include 1255 H C.

I've read anything and everything I could on this issue the past few days and it's led me to Bill's write up on the ignition switch, along with kenhorse who suggested I try that repair.

I have a warranty on the car and was going to take it in but I don't want them to start throwing parts at something I may be able to fix myself. I am going to check my battery and look for grounding issues but I'm pretty well worthless with elctrical issues on these things.

Suggestions or comments? what do the experts think?

Clear the codes and see if they come back. Starting but barely idling, I would be looking at the battery first to insure you've got enough power to run the car. Battery connections of course.

I had the same with my 02 coupe couple months ago. DIC message was System Fault Charge. My wife was driving home and she said it stalled on her at a light and was able to restart but turned right on our street and the thing died. I walked down and got it started but it seemed like half power. Got it home, changed the battery, changed the alternator (I pulled both from our other C5), checked cables to starter. It would just be dead at the key but still had lights working. Couple days later it started and I take it down the road to my service shop and next day it was fixed...IT WAS THE IGNITION SWITCH. $145 part and $145 labor. Been great since.
